Abstract
preparação de biblioteca genômica e ensaios epigenéticos direcionados com o uso de ribonucleoproteínas de cas-grna. a presente invenção fornece a preparação de biblioteca genômica com o uso de rnps de cas-grna e ensaios epigenéticos direcionados. algumas composições incluem, de uma primeira espécie, substancialmente apenas os polinucleotídeos de fita simples; de uma segunda espécie, substancialmente apenas polinucleotídeos de fita dupla; e iniciadores de amplificação ligados às extremidades dos segundos polinucleotídeos de fita dupla e substancialmente não ligados a quaisquer extremidades dos primeiros polinucleotídeos de fita dupla. algumas composições incluem uma primeira e uma segunda moléculas de um polinucleotídeo alvo que tem uma sequência, a primeira molécula tendo uma primeira extremidade em uma primeira subsequência, a segunda molécula tendo uma primeira extremidade em uma segunda subsequência, em que a primeira subsequência se sobrepõe apenas parcialmente à segunda subsequência. alguns exemplos fornecem uma composição que inclui um polinucleotídeo alvo e uma primeira proteína de fusão incluindo uma rnp de cas-grna acoplada a uma transposase que tem um adaptador de amplificação acoplado à mesma. a rnp de cas-grna pode ser hibridizada com uma subsequência no polinucleotídeo alvo.
